Chief Election Commissioner (CEC) Sunil Arora has instructed Rajasthan election officials to run a special drive on voter awareness in the districts which recorded lower turn out in the 2014 Lok Sabha elections. Arora was chairing a meeting with senior officials of state election department at the secretariat on Friday.

“The department should run a voters awareness drive in the districts where the lower voter turn out was recorded in previous Lok Sabha elections. Also the drives should be aimed to increase participations of youth and women in the coming elections. Camps must be held in colleges to make youths aware about voting right and the amenities at the polling booths must be ensured for convenience of especially abled voters,” Arora directed the officials.

Rajasthan chief electoral officer Anand Kumar present in the meeting gave feedback to the CEC about the preparations of the LS elections due in April-May. “Preparations for FLC (first level checking) of EVMs and VVPAT machines are in full swing and the training for poll officers will start soon. Also the department is continuously monitoring the preparations by having regular video conferencing with divisional commissioners and district collectors. As soon a the date of polls is announced other preparations will be done simultaneously,” told Kumar to the CEC.

Arora is on two-day tour to Jaipur from Friday to take stock of the Lok Sabha election preparations. After holding meeting with state election department officials he on Saturday would chair a meeting on law and order with DGP Kapil Garg and chief secretary DB Gupta. Transfer policy of poll duty officers, electoral offences, deployment of personnels at critical polling booths and other law and order issues are agenda of the proposed meeting.

Sources add that the full commission of Election Commission of India (ECI) is expected to hold a meeting with senior officials on LS preparations again on March 12-13 after model code of conduct is put in force for the LS elections. This meeting will be crucial in giving final touch to the poll preparations.

The state election department is all geared up to conduct parliamentary elections. The department in January held special camps for ratification of the electoral rolls, by adding eligible voters. 

A special drive was also launched to remove double and multi entries of the voters. The department is expected to release final draft of rolls on February 22.
